The invention discloses a mobile robot chassis with an active anti-shake pneumatic device, which belongs to the technical field of mobile robots and comprises a chassis carrier fixedly mounted above a robot chassis through the active anti-shake pneumatic device. The active anti-shake pneumatic device is fixed between the robot chassis and the chassis carrier through a connecting device, and the active anti-shake pneumatic device comprises a first air spring, a second air spring, a third air spring and a fourth air spring. According to the mobile robot chassis with the active anti-shaking pneumatic device, the active pneumatic device and the upper bottom plate are connected through the damping device, the supporting effect can be achieved, vibration generated in the running process of a mobile robot can be absorbed, shaking on a bumpy road surface is better prevented, and the service life of the mobile robot is prolonged. Therefore, better anti-shaking and stabilizing effects are achieved, and the anti-shaking and stabilizing device can be applied to stable work in a conventional pavement environment and can also be applied to self-adaptive operation in occasions with severe terrains and environments.
